Background on OCRF:
OCRF was established in the 2019 legislative session (HB 2829) with $1 million in state funding promised if $1 million in private dollars is also obtained. ODFW is working with the Oregon Wildlife Foundation to meet that goal. The OCRF Advisory Committee advises the Oregon Fish and Wildlife Commission on use of the Fund. The Committee will have 9 members appointed by the governor, and their geographic representation was determined by the Oregon Fish and Wildlife Commission at their October 11th meeting.
